Rights Group seeks `justice' for disabled girl

Staff Reporter

NEW DELHI: Disabled Rights Group, a non-political advocacy group, has written to the Joint Secretary in the Bureau of University and Higher Education (Administration), Sunil Kumar, seeking his intervention in getting a single-room hostel accommodation for Pooja Sharma, a disabled girl from Meerut, at Symbiosis Law College in Pune.

In his letter, Disabled Rights Group Executive Director Javed Abidi said: "Pooja being severely disabled needed a single room but for some strange reason the college authorities and hotel in-charge have allotted her a triple-seater room.

``It seems that the college authorities are consciously demoralising the girl and her family with the intention that she leave the college.''

Mr. Abidi has asked Mr. Kumar to examine the matter "as a policy issue because in keeping with the letter and the spirit of the Disability Act, severely disabled students and wheelchair users should be given priority in such matters''.

"At our level, we have tried our best but so far the college authorities have not relented. Your firm intervention can make all the difference,'' he said.
